0

私は自分のapkで遊んでいます。アプリのインストール時にコンバージョンを発生させたいのですが、一意のコンバージョン ID をアプリに渡す方法がわかりません。

これが私がやりたいことです。

  1. ユーザーは自分のクリック ID で apk をインストールします: http://www.example.com/myapk.apk?click=dfsg-fdsfwe-43fsdf-43sdf

  2. クリック パラメータはアプリの起動時に発生します

    Uri uri = Uri.parse("http://mytracker.com/click=dfsg-fdsfwe-43fsdf-43sdf");
    Intent intent = new Intent(Intent.ACTION_VIEW, uri);
    startActivity(intent);
    

私を正しい方向に向けてください。それを行うためのより良い方法があれば、私に知らせてください。

ps Adjust.com をアプリ内トラッカーとして使用していますが、これがどのように役立つかわかりませんでした。

4

1 に答える 1

0

Google Play には、インストール リファラーのチェック機能があります。

  • BroadcastReceiverアクションに反応するアプリを作成しますcom.android.vending.INSTALL_REFERRER
  • ユーザーは のようなリンクからインストールしますhttp://play.google.com/store/apps/details?id=your.app.id&referrer=referrer_string
  • BroadcastReceiver が呼び出され、取得できますreferrer_string

    @Override
    public void onReceive(Context context, Intent intent) {
        String referrer = intent.getStringExtra("referrer");
    }
    
于 2015-02-24T09:02:26.310 に答える